Contents:
Chapter 1. Introduction Chapter 2. $J$-holomorphic curves Chapter 3. Moduli spaces and transversality Chapter 4. Compactness Chapter 5. Stable maps Chapter 6. Moduli spaces of stable maps Chapter 7. Gromov-Witten invariants Chapter 8. Hamiltonian perturbations Chapter 9. Applications in symplectic topology Chapter 10. Gluing Chapter 11. Quantum cohomology Chapter 12. Floer cohomology Appendix A. Fredholm theory Appendix B. Elliptic regularity Appendix C. The Riemann-Roch theorem Appendix D. Stable curves of genus zero Appendix E. Singularities and intersections (written with Laurent Lazzarini)
